FUTTIES was officially announced by EA Sports at FIFA 22. The first poll is officially live and features players who can upgrade to a five-star weak leg skill, along with a massive stat upgrade.
There were three options in the first round: Luis Diaz, Aaron Wan-Bissaka and Kai Havertz. The two highest rated players will receive a raised card and a weak leg brace. Here are the voters of the first category FUTTIES Voice Weak Foot.

All three players could craft great FUTTIES items if they received a five-star weak leg upgrade. However, only two of them can benefit from incentives.
Kai Havertz is undoubtedly one of the keys to the first FUTTIES sound. With its past binding ability and solid cards, it’s arguably the most popular choice among the three FUTTIES competitors. The five-star weak leg makes him and Timo Werner’s Shapeshifter one of the best relationships in the game.
As for the second option, players can also choose Luis Diaz instead of Wan-Bissaka. Luis Diaz is another Premier League winger and his pace, along with his low five-star foot and high shot from the FUTTIES spot, will put him in the Premier League top three.
Wan-Bissaka is a solid player, but it will be difficult for him to compete with the large number of defenders already in play in the Premier League, such as new shape-shifter Dan James. Probably best to go with Havertz or Diaz.
